引言
《剑灵》作为一款深受玩家喜爱的网络游戏,其丰富的世界观和复杂的游戏系统吸引了大量玩家。数据库攻略在游戏中扮演着至关重要的角色,它可以帮助玩家更好地了解游戏机制,提高游戏体验。本文将带领玩家全面解析《剑灵》数据库攻略,帮助大家破解游戏奥秘。
一、数据库基础
1.1 数据库概述
数据库是存储、管理和检索数据的系统。在《剑灵》中,数据库用于存储游戏中的各种信息,如角色属性、装备数据、任务信息等。
1.2 数据库类型
《剑灵》中的数据库主要分为以下几种类型:
- 系统数据库:存储游戏基本数据,如角色属性、技能、装备等。
- 玩家数据库:存储玩家角色信息,如角色等级、装备、任务等。
- 临时数据库:存储游戏中的临时数据,如战斗状态、任务进度等。
二、数据库查询
2.1 查询基础
查询是数据库操作的核心,通过查询可以获取所需的数据信息。在《剑灵》中,玩家可以通过以下方式查询数据库:
- 游戏内查询:通过游戏内的查询界面,输入查询条件,如角色名、装备名称等。
- 第三方查询工具:使用专门的第三方查询工具,如17173数据库查询器等。
2.2 查询示例
以下是一个查询角色装备的示例代码:
SELECT * FROM player_equip WHERE player_id = 123456;
这条SQL语句表示查询玩家ID为123456的装备信息。
三、数据库更新
3.1 更新基础
数据库更新是修改数据库中数据的过程。在《剑灵》中,玩家可以通过以下方式更新数据库:
- 游戏内操作:通过游戏内的界面进行更新,如升级装备、完成任务等。
- 脚本操作:使用游戏脚本进行批量更新,如批量升级角色等。
3.2 更新示例
以下是一个使用游戏脚本批量升级角色的示例代码:
import requests
# 定义角色ID列表
player_ids = [123456, 123457, 123458]
# 定义升级参数
params = {
'action': 'upgrade',
'player_ids': player_ids
}
# 发送请求
response = requests.post('http://example.com/api/upgrade', data=params)
# 处理响应
if response.status_code == 200:
print('升级成功')
else:
print('升级失败')
四、数据库优化
4.1 优化原则
数据库优化是提高数据库性能的关键。以下是一些数据库优化原则:
- 合理设计数据库结构:根据游戏需求,设计合理的数据库结构,提高数据存储效率。
- 优化查询语句:优化查询语句,提高查询速度。
- 使用索引:合理使用索引,提高查询效率。
4.2 优化示例
以下是一个优化查询语句的示例:
-- 原始查询语句
SELECT * FROM player_equip WHERE level > 50;
-- 优化后的查询语句
SELECT * FROM player_equip WHERE level > 50 ORDER BY level DESC;
优化后的查询语句增加了ORDER BY子句,按照等级降序排列,提高了查询效率。
五、总结
本文全面解析了《剑灵》数据库攻略,从数据库基础、查询、更新到优化,为玩家提供了详细的指导。希望本文能帮助玩家更好地理解游戏数据库,提高游戏体验。
